Are the fruits of ornamental plants edible?

1. Let’s first talk about whether the red ones in these fruits are edible. Among them are some ornamental plants of the genus Malus in the Rosaceae family, such as the weeping crabapple, the Chinese crabapple and many other crabapple-like flowers. The fruits of these plants are about 5 cm in size and length. The fruits look very similar, and are all red and very bright. There is also a layer of shiny wax on the surface of the fruit. These fruits taste slightly sour and are very delicious. Moreover, plants of this family produce more fruits. When it snows in winter, the thin white snow falls on the red fruits, which is particularly beautiful.

2. Among the red fruits, Pyracantha and Loquat are definitely edible. Although they may not taste very good, some plants in the Rosaceae family taste sour, which is considered to be a unique flavor. What are the red plants that cannot be eaten? For example, Nandina domestica can cause poisoning if eaten too much.

3. Inside the yellow fruits, ginkgo will produce some small yellow fruits, which are more nutritious, but you can’t eat too much. Another edible fruit is loquat. There are some small hairs on the surface of the fruit. It tastes sweet and sour and is edible.

4. Purple fruits, such as Callicarpa ovata, are edible and very beautiful. There is also a kind called Meronia, which has good medicinal value and can be eaten. Eleutherococcus senticosus is edible, but there is a kind of kiwi fruit whose fruit is purple, which is not edible.

5. If it is white, it is the Hubei mountain ash which is edible. The snow fruit tastes bitter and is not suitable for eating.
